Output e89d3064b079d31e802666293d3e8e4bfcd8bfbc08e9f703c19da30a3d2383a7:0

value
5200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3765c11c0fc5dab91eab1454a61ba182ea663 OP_EQUAL
address
3BMEXkDyjsqq7fVWYy2pHKbH8PsJXDESmz
transaction
e89d3064b079d31e802666293d3e8e4bfcd8bfbc08e9f703c19da30a3d2383a7
confirmations
385435
spent
true